‘The Mooknayak’ honored with International Award for its public interest journalism

The Mooknayak English

New Delhi— The Ambedkar Association of North America (AANA) has honored The Mooknayak with the AANA International Award 2022. The award was presented at an event held in the city of Detroit, Michigan, United States.

Pankaj Meshram, Secretary, AANA, said that this international award is given in recognition of social work that is informed by the teachings of Dr. B.R. Ambedkar, Mahatma Phule, Savitri Bai Phule, and Gautam Buddha as well as the economic and social impact of this work at a broader level. The Mooknayak, a media organization in India, was selected by the jury for the International Award this year.

Meena Kotwal, founder of The Mooknayak received the AANA Award

The Mooknayak has been given this award for its sensitive reporting of Dalit, Adivasi, minority, and women's issues and for raising the voice of the oppressed communities. In an event organized on the birth anniversary of Babasaheb Bhim Rao Ambedkar, The Mooknayak's delegate was presented with the International Award trophy, certificate, and prize money.

About AANA

The Ambedkar Association of North America (AANA) is the leading partner organization for educational and health programmes in the United States and around the world. At the same time, the organization also actively participates in social reform projects. SmitaDandge, President, AANA, and the other office-bearers congratulated The Mooknayak team for winning the International Award.
